Nelara, an Old Ebonheart trader under pressure for protection money

Nelara is a Dark Elf trader and resident of the Old Ebonheart slums in the east of the city. During the events of the Thieves Guild quest, Facing Eviction, she comes under pressure from the goons of rising crimelord, Otrebus Delagia, and Wry-Eye Moranie will send you to intervene.

She wears a common shirt with matching skirt and shoes. She carries 6 gold.

Aside from her natural resistance to fire and the sanctuary provided by her ancestors, she knows the following spells: Absorb Health (Ranged), Almalexia's Grace, Almsivi Intervention, Divine Intervention, and Telekinesis.
